Abstract

The hydrogenation of two liquid terpenes, α-pinene and limonene, was carried out in the presence of high-pressure carbon dioxide, using carbon-supported Pt catalysts. Phase equilibrium data on terpene + CO2 + hydrogen were used to interpret the kinetics of hydrogenation in liquid + vapor systems close to the critical lines of the mixtures.
